Story-Based Learning Children are naturally drawn to stories. Long before worksheets and textbooks, humans learned through legends, songs, shared experiences, and storytelling. Story-based learning taps into that timeless connection by transforming education into something meaningful, memorable, and emotionally engaging. At the heart of Enchanted Pathways: Learning Through Stories & Imagination is the belief that stories help children connect ideas across subjects while developing empathy, creativity, and critical thinking. Using the stories that they know and love, children are more likely to stay engaged, retain information, and form deeper understanding. A story-centered approach allows learners to: -Build emotional connections to what they study -Explore complex themes in age-appropriate ways -Strengthen comprehension and communication skills -Encourage curiosity and imaginative thinking -Make interdisciplinary connections naturally -Learn through experience, discussion, and creativity rather than memorization alone Through stories, children can explore science on tropical islands, study geography through cultural journeys, practice math in real-world adventures, and develop social-emotional skills by relating to characters and their experiences. Stories create context — and context helps learning stick. Story-based education also supports a wide range of learners. Visual learners, hands-on learners, reluctant readers, neurodivergent students, and highly creative children often thrive when lessons feel immersive and connected rather than isolated and repetitive. In Enchanted Pathways, stories become doorways: -Doorways into history and culture -Doorways into emotional growth -Doorways into creativity and wonder -Doorways into meaningful academic learning Because when children feel connected to what they are learning, education becomes more than a requirement — it becomes an adventure.
